Maxigesic Recovery Report: NRL and NRLW squad updates

One New Zealand Warriors co-captain James Fisher-Harris, second rower Leka Halasima and centre Rocco Berry are on track to return to action after this week’s bye round.

Fisher-Harris is recovering from a calf injury and Halasima and Berry from hamstring complaints.

All three are on track to be available for selection for the Warriors’ round 19 clash against the Wests Tigers on July 10.

Prop Jackson Ford is recovering after surgery on the pectoral injury he suffered 20 minutes into the Warriors’ 38-20 round 16 victory over North Queensland in Christchurch.

It is yet to be confirmed when winger Alofi’ana Khan-Pereira will be available again after picking up a leg injury in the loss to the Sharks.

Four of the club’s NRLW players are sidelined after picking up preseason injuries.

New signing Mele Hufanga has a hamstring strain while middle forward Matekino Gray (foot), Kaiyah Atai (thumb) and outside back Anastasia Sekene (ankle) have all been sidelined with injuries picked up in the Warriors' trial against Brisbane in Christchurch.

Previously sidelined for the season was outside back Tyra Wetere, who suffered a season-ending ACL knee injury during an offseason stint in France.
